Vaccine Man is a minor antagonist of One-Punch Man. He is the very first villain Saitama faces in the series, and is said to be a dragon-level threat. Formed from the pollution on Earth, Vaccine Man is determined to extinguish humanity's existence.
He was voiced by Ryūsei Nakao (who also voiced Frieza in the Dragon Ball franchise, Caesar Clown in One Piece, Mayuri Kurotsuchi in Bleach, and Agent Abrella in Tokusou Sentai Dekaranger) in Japanese and Christopher Sabat (who also voiced Vegeta and Piccolo in the Dragon Ball franchise) in English.
Appearance[]
Vaccine Man appears as a regular yet muscular purple humanoid figure. He is 2 meters (6'7") tall, has two antennae on his forehead, and veins across his entire body.
In his enhanced form, he gains spikes all over his body, sharp, long teeth, and claws. His size also increases to great heights, becoming 18 meters (59'1") tall.
Biography[]
Introduction Saga[]
Vaccine Man shows up near City A and causes mass destruction to the city with his powers. To defeat Vaccine Man, the heros Lightning Max and Smile Man were sent to him, but they were defeated easily. Later, he sees a schoolgirl crying and tries to grab her and crush her, but Saitama quickly shows up and saves the kid. Vaccine Man starts explaining his mission, claiming he was born from the desires of Mother Earth, a single living organism, and that humans are a disease which is killing the planet and must be eradicated. He gets enraged when Saitama tells him he is a hero for fun, transforming into a more demonic form and attacking Saitama, who easily destroys him with a single punch.
Powers and Abilities[]
Powers[]
- Energy Projection - Vaccine Man is able to project blue-colored energy from his hands, using it for destructive purposes.
- Transformation - Vaccine Man is able to transform into an enhanced form, where his strength increases
- Flight - By surrounding himself with energy, Vaccine Man is able to fly several feet in the air.
Abilities[]
- Superhuman Strength - Although we never see Vaccine Man use his strength, we can presume that he's very strong because of his dragon-level threat level and because he easily defeated two A-rank hero's.

Trivia[]
- Vaccine Man and Piccolo are very similar in appearance, making many fans of both shows believe that Vaccine Man might have been inspired by Piccolo.
- Saitama's victory over Vaccine Man was credited toward King, who later, after many similar occurrences, became a S-Rank hero, even though he didn't fight once in his life.
